This delicious salmon dish has a traditional Chinese twist. Eat warm, then enjoy leftovers cold. This dish helps support healthy Kidney function.

Ingredients

 1 lb of salmon
 2 scallions, cut into 2 inch strips
 Ginger, finely sliced
 1 teaspoon of salt
 1/4 cup of cooking wine
 1/4 cup of soy sauce
 1 teaspoon of sugar
 1 Tablespoon of hoisin sauce
 1 Tablespoon of orange marmalade
 Oil, drizzled over fish

Directions

1

Line a pyrex pan with scallions, then add the fish.

2

in a small bowl add all the remaining ingredients except the oil. Mix well and pour over the fish.

3

Drizzle the oil over the fish.

4

Bake uncovered for 15 minutes, 400 degrees. Then adjust the oven to broil and continue to cook the fish for 2 more minutes.
